Animals depicted are Moose and Antler and their story is below:

During one of our biggest snowstorms this past winter, Donna was driving around East St. Louis looking for any animals who may need our help. She ended up seeing three older puppies who were obviously searching for food. Because our shelter was so full at the time and these pups did not appear to be injured, Donna was only planning to give these pups a nice big meal and put them on her list to return to feed and hopefully rescue when we had more space in our shelter. However, as she was feeding them, a man from the neighborhood ran up asking if they were her dogs. When she said no, he said "well the next time you see them, they may be face down - I'm gonna shoot 'em! One of them stole my boot off the porch and I had to go in the snow with one shoe!!" Since we felt they were in immediate danger, Donna decided to go ahead and rescue them! Unfortunately the third puppy ran off and disappeared. She was only able to rescue Moose & Antler that day in the snow. Moose & Antler were very shy at first and didn't know how to trust humans. However, with a little patience and a lot of work - they learned that humans were not all bad! They were adopted together to a loving forever home and now get to live their days playing in the backyard and snuggling on the couch or a big, soft dog bed! They even have a shy/feral foster sister who they are helping to socialize, too! We eventually ended up finding and rescuing the third puppy, who we named Guppy - she quickly got adopted by a loving family as well! We love happy endings!


Status: Adopted!
